Natuadangi Population - Uttar Dinajpur, West Bengal

Natuadangi is a medium size village located in Kaliaganj Block of Uttar Dinajpur district, West Bengal with total 317 families residing. The Natuadangi village has population of 1365 of which 682 are males while 683 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Natuadangi village population of children with age 0-6 is 164 which makes up 12.01 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Natuadangi village is 1001 which is higher than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Natuadangi as per census is 1216, higher than West Bengal average of 956.

Natuadangi village has lower liter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Natuadangi village was 64.86 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Natuadangi Male literacy stands at 74.18 % while female literacy rate was 55.31 %.

Caste Factor

In Natuadangi village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 71.79 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 1.03 % of total population in Natuadangi village.

Work Profile

In Natuadangi village out of total population, 570 were engaged in work activities. 95.26 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 4.74 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 570 workers engaged in Main Work, 142 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 256 were Agricultural labourer.
